Changing Default Transition Possible in FCExpress 2?

Does anybody know of a way to change the default video transition being something other than "Cross-Dissolve 1 sec"?
"Set Default Transition" may be a Right-Click option in FCPro, but I cannot find it anywhere in my FCE version 2.
IMac Mac OS X (10.3.9)

You can set up a customised transition of your choice as a "Favorite". Not quite as convenient as a "default" but it should help a little.

  • How to Change Default Transition Time?

    In FCE, how do I change the default 1 sec period of a transition, Cross Dissolve for example?
    Also, can I apply a transition to a series of clips in the Timeline rather than individually for each clip using the Canvas.
    I'm trying to improve my efficiency as I make a slide show of many still pics with transitions.

    In FCE the only workaround is to alter the transition in the Viewer and drag the altered transition back into the Browser>Favourites Bin.
    When you edit using this transition in the future it will assign at the altered value each time it's used.
    Think of it as auto assigned transition that has to used manually each time.

  • Change default boot display, is it possible?

    Hi!
    I have MSI N660 TF 2GD5 OC card with two devices connected: 1) LCD monitor via DVI-D, 2) Projector via DVI-A.
    Every time I turn on the PC I don't see anything on monitor until Windows starts. Video output during boot process goes to projector even though it's turned off.
    Is it possible to change default output during system start up?
    Swapping connectors isn't possible physically, because DVI-A have extra pins that won't fit to another socket.
    If not, whats socket "default priority"? I'm thinking of buying hdmi cable for my projector to fix issue, will it help?

    The dual link DVI-I connector you are most likely using for the DVI-A device is the primary connector. If it is connected to any display it will always be used for primary display when starting.
    Solution would be to use the Projector with a DVI-A or I to HDMI or Displayport adapter or DVI-A or I to DVI-D adapter so you can use the monitor with the DVI-I connector.

  • Change of transitions

    Hi again all!
    I would like to change of transition type. There is just one type of transition for appearence of a component, is it possible to do like on Microsoft PowerPoint (for example) with a chekckerboard transition, for example.
    Thank you for your help^^

    You can add various effects to your timeline to create different transitions.  For example, use a Fade effect (stretched out over time -- use the Smooth Transition button to do this automatically) to have the component fade out.  Or use a Resize to have it shrink down to a pinprick.  Or you can use Rotate 3D to spin it until you're viewing it edge-on (so it's just a vertical line), followed by a quick Fade out to make it fully invisible.
    There's not an easy way to create a checkerboard effect, but here's one way to fake it: If you have a solid-colored background you could put a bunch of rectangles on top of the item that appear at the start of the timeline (do a quick Fade in, or Set Property visible->true), then resize until they fully cover the item.

  • Can't apply default transitions or copy attributes

    I have no means of getting Premiere to apply default transitions.
    I select clips, try via Sequence menu, nada
    I place the cursor on the timeline Ctrl-D, nothing happens
    I copy a clip and paste attributes - NOTHING. No change at all.
    Could there be any setting I didn't set? Default transitions are set, and I can copy/paste audio attributes/clip effects, but nothing happens in Video.

    Select clip and then go to select Sequence / Apply Default Transition To Selection (you can make this into a Keyboard Shortcut) this will make a transition at beginning and end of the clip at the same time. If you only want just one side, select the side with the Roll Edit or Ripple Trim tool and hit Apply Default Transition To Selection.
    If you want to put a cross dissolve between a whole bunch of clips. Select clip and hit Apply Default Transition to Selection.

  • Change default settings when user share file

    When users click on share file default setting is:
    Can edit and mark send an email invitation.
    Is there possible to change to:
    Can view and NOT mark an email invitation

    Hi,
    According to your description, you want to change default settings to
    can view and uncheck send an email invitation when user share file.
    To by default uncheck send an email invitation.  Go to the file "C:\Program Files\Common Files\Microsoft Shared\Web Server Extensions\15\TEMPLATE\LAYOUTS\AclInv.aspx".
    You can change:
    <wssawc:InputFormCheckBox
    runat="server"
    id="chkSendEmail"
    Checked="True"
    LabelText="<%$Resources:wss,aclver_SendEmailCheckbox%>"
    To
    <wssawc:InputFormCheckBox
    runat="server"
    id="chkSendEmail"
    Checked="False"
    LabelText="<%$Resources:wss,aclver_SendEmailCheckbox%>"
    Here is a similar post, you can use as a reference:
    https://social.technet.microsoft.com/Forums/office/en-US/f250aa4a-94f0-4603-9da2-e9040d5d6133/how-to-by-default-uncheck-send-an-email-invitation-when-granting-access?forum=sharepointadmin
    To by default can view. Go to the file "C:\Program Files\Common Files\Microsoft Shared\Web Server Extensions\15\TEMPLATE\LAYOUTS\AclInv.aspx".
    You can add the following code into the function _spBodyOnLoad():
    document. querySelector('[id$=DdlsimplifiedRoles]').value="role:1073741826";
